Output de9019bbc2aff01f59c2e26edfa751dfde7e5da707837154b2362eaed41731bc:1

value
1446987
script pubkey
OP_0 OP_PUSHBYTES_20 d5c7aa173c3a5d3adbb153da74c2d3bd824be818
address
bc1q6hr659eu8fwn4ka320d8fsknhkpyh6qc0rqpce
transaction
de9019bbc2aff01f59c2e26edfa751dfde7e5da707837154b2362eaed41731bc
confirmations
38734
spent
true